Description: The invention relates to a device for collecting cleaning liquid accumulating during the cleaning of facades, having a cleaning liquid-impermeable collecting device and a suction element. When cleaning the facade catching devices are known (for example DE 4231933 AI) which have a collecting tray for running off the facade and depending on the degree of contamination differently contaminated with dirt particles cleaning liquid. This sump includes a suction element, via which the dirty cleaning liquid can be sucked off via a pump and stored for disposal or filtered and recycled. Such sumps have the disadvantage that they usually need to be mounted on the facade such as to be screwed, which has damage to the facade surface. Due to increasing legal requirements, it is also necessary to largely absorb the cleaning fluid again and avoid leakage and thus pollution of the environment and / or groundwater. For this purpose, it has been proposed to provide drip trays made of collapsible film tubs (DE 4029757 AI) which can be suspended with their towering tub edges in a facade scaffold. However, such foil trays have the disadvantage that they are relatively stiff in the longitudinal direction and therefore can not adapt adequately to a variable in height underground. In addition, just in the area of such height changes, there is only an insufficient seal towards the façade, whereby the danger of leakage of the cleaning liquid used is given. The invention is therefore based on the object, a collecting device of the type described above in such a way that a complete collection of the cleaning liquid is made possible even at different height levels and unevenness of the ground. The invention solves the problem set by the fact that the collecting device forms a collecting mat, which has on its one longitudinal side a bendable abutment edge for the facade and on the other longitudinal side a bent up with releasable brackets guide surface for the cleaning liquid. According to these measures, the collecting mat can also be correspondingly flexible in the longitudinal direction, so that it can adapt well to the respective height level of the ground and thereby the flexible, aufbiegbare abutment sand alone by its own weight is pressed against the facade, so that leakage of cleaning fluid at the transition between abutment sand and facade is avoided. Depending on the height level of the ground, the collecting mat can be bent up to a guide surface for the cleaning liquid with different numbers of clamps on the long side opposite the contact edge. Number and strength of these brackets must be chosen so that the fluid pressure of the collected in the bent collecting mat cleaning fluid can be withstood. If the brackets are not mounted directly in the region of the end face of the guide surface, but set back in the transverse direction of the collecting mat from this end, as is apparent in particular from the following drawings, the guide surface of the collecting mat advantageously forms a splash guard for the cleaning fluid, because the guide surface over the folded by the brackets folded back part is extended upwards. In order to keep the liquid pressure against the guide surface as low as possible and thus to keep the number and strength of the clamps for the guide surface low, the invention proposes that a Flachsaugmatte is provided as a suction. This is because flat suction mats have the advantage that suction can take place even with very low liquid levels, as is to be feared in particular with varying height levels of the ground. Because it can come to a dry running of the suction pump depending on the amount of cleaning fluid and the suction system used, it is proposed according to the invention that a suction pump with overheat protection is connected to the suction. This is particularly advantageous if a Flachsaugmatte is provided as a suction or a continuous without interruptions suction pump is used. Especially with rough and irregular facades, the rigidity of the collecting mat can cause a proper seal to the facade despite the pressed with his own weight to the facade investment edge is no longer given. It is therefore proposed according to the invention that the end face of the abutment edge is provided with a time-degradable by the detergent degradable grout, which will be described in more detail below. The invention also relates to a method for collecting cleaning fluid in the cleaning of facades, initially a cleaning liquid-impermeable collecting mat is laid along the facade, after which a bendable longitudinal edge of the collecting mat applied as an abutment against the facade and the opposite longitudinal edge using releasable brackets is bent to a guide surface for the cleaning liquid. Following this procedure, the collecting mat can first be placed on the ground, with the collecting mat adapts to the height levels of the substrate. Then the collecting mat is used on the facade, the plant edge is bent and in particular with its front side is applied to the facade. After this, the longitudinal edge of the collecting mat, which lies opposite the abutment edge, can be lifted by means of releasable clamps to form a guide surface for the cleaning liquid. Number and distance of the brackets to each other can be selected as above depending on the height levels of the ground and the associated curvature of the collecting mat and in dependence on the expected liquid pressure against the guide surface. In order to achieve a secure seal to the facade, it is further proposed that the connection joint is sealed in the transition region between the edge of the investment and the facade with a time-degradable by the detergent degradable grout. The grout is designed so that on the one hand slowly in the cleaning liquid is soluble and on the other hand forms a repellent cleaning liquid pasty emulsion. If, for example, water is provided as the cleaning liquid, the grout may consist of a polymer which is difficult to dissolve in water and forms, together with additives, a conditionally water-repellent, soapy, paste-like emulsion. Sealing for about 30 minutes with water can be achieved, for example, by a composition of less than 2% by weight of a polyalkylene glycol ether based polymer, about 5% by weight of additives and water. This grout can either already be applied as described above on the front side of the collecting mat or be applied only after the installation of the collecting mat on the front side of the abutment edge. By a subsequent elapse of the grout, for example, with a flexible scraper, unevenness of the plaster surface is filled and it forms an oblique to the facade and collecting mat down sloping joint mass film over which the cleaning agent substantially tangential to the surface of the joint mass filament during the cleaning of the facade in the collecting mat expires. The grout is slowly dissolved in the cleaning agent, so that after completion of the cleaning no residues of the grout remain on the facade. The inventive device comprises a collecting mat 1 as a catcher for collecting incurred in the cleaning of facades cleaning fluids. The collecting mat 1 forms on its longitudinal side a deflectable abutment edge 2 for the facade 3 and on its other longitudinal side a deflected with releasable staples 4 guide surface 5 on the cleaning liquid. As Absaugelement a resting on the collecting mat 1 Flachsaugmatte 6 is provided, which is connected as shown schematically in Fig. 2 via a suction line 7 with a pump 8. Expiring cleaning liquid can thus on the Flachsaugmatte 6 as a suction and the pump 8 in a collecting container 9. In order to avoid damage to the pump 8 during dry running, this invention may be equipped with an overheating protection. According to a particularly advantageous embodiment of the invention, the transition region between the abutment sand 2 and facade 3 with a time-delayed by the detergent degradable grout 10 are sealed.
